How you use it will help with recommendations on what size kit. 916 you can still trail ride any bigger they can run hot
"Bankrupt"
10-12-2011, 08:39 PM
Yeah, going much bigger and it will cause problems trail riding unless you go with Greg's oil cooler kit. Hell, I actually recommend you running one no matter what size kit you get.
Plus it gives you the advantage of using oil filters from a auto parts store instead of having to get one from BRP.
